cdevroe unmark up to 1.9.3 Marks.php Title cross site scripting

Summary
A vulnerability was found in cdevroe unmark up to 1.9.3. It has been rated as problematic. Impacted is an unknown function of the file /application/controllers/Marks.php. Performing a manipulation of the argument Title results in cross site scripting. This vulnerability is reported as CVE-2025-10331. The attack is possible to be carried out remotely. Moreover, an exploit is present. The vendor was contacted early about this disclosure but did not respond in any way.
Details
A vulnerability classified as problematic has been found in cdevroe unmark up to 1.9.3. This affects an unknown function of the file /application/controllers/Marks.php. The manipulation of the argument title with an unknown input leads to a cross site scripting vulnerability. CWE is classifying the issue as CWE-79. The product does not neutralize or incorrectly neutralizes user-controllable input before it is placed in output that is used as a web page that is served to other users. This is going to have an impact on integrity.
The advisory is shared at github.com. This vulnerability is uniquely identified as CVE-2025-10331. The exploitability is told to be easy. It is possible to initiate the attack remotely. It demands that the victim is doing some kind of user interaction. Technical details and a public exploit are known. MITRE ATT&CK project uses the attack technique T1059.007 for this issue.
The exploit is shared for download at github.com. It is declared as proof-of-concept. The vendor was contacted early about this disclosure but did not respond in any way. By approaching the search of inurl:application/controllers/Marks.php it is possible to find vulnerable targets with Google Hacking.
There is no information about possible countermeasures known. It may be suggested to replace the affected object with an alternative product.
